Hello, we're First Century Bank, N.A.

First Century Bank, N.A. is a small, community bank headquartered in Commerce, Georgia but we are not your typical local bank. What sets us apart is our forward-thinking approach to growth and technology integration. We operate at the unique intersection of traditional banking and modern financial technology, offering a rare opportunity for professionals to work with innovative Fintech solutions within the structure of a well-established institution.

As one of the few community banks actively supporting Fintech partnerships, we deliver backend support for prepaid card programs and other emerging fintech products. We're seeking a Business & Systems Analyst at our Commerce, Georgia location to verify data integrity, enhance banking platforms, and support cross-functional fintech implementations through thoughtful data analysis and system optimization.

As a Full-Time Data & System Analyst at First Century Bank, you will play a pivotal role in ensuring our operational efficiency by verifying data integrity, setups, and key performance indicators (KPIs). Your expertise will be crucial in troubleshooting and enhancing our banking platform's performance, contributing to a seamless customer experience. You will support the implementation of system enhancements aimed at improving efficiency and accuracy, while also developing and maintaining vital workflows and process documentation.

Additionally, you will manage comprehensive system change logs, ensuring that all modifications are tracked accurately. This position not only promises a rewarding challenge but also allows you to innovate within a fun and flexible environment!

  • Analyze and validate data, setups, and KPIs to maintain operational excellence and support strategic decision-making.
  • Troubleshoot and improve banking platform performance.
  • Support and implement system enhancements for efficiency and accuracy.
  • Develop and maintain workflows, process documentation, and system change logs.
  • Provide data insights and recommendations to support projects and process improvements.
  • Manage IT scripting plans, verification, and implementation tracking.
  • Test and verify IT script implementations and system enhancements.
  • Manage and approve BW (Business Workflow) development tickets and programming requests.
  • Monitor origination limits and ensure compliance with regulatory and internal policies.
  • Ensure accurate and compliant customer portal configurations.
  • Set up and manage user permissions in banking portals.
  • Serve as escalation support for system and data-related issues.
  • Prepare for audits, risk assessments, and support BSA (Bank Secrecy Act) compliance.
  • Manage customer and HOA setups, limits, routing, and rules in banking platforms.
  • Oversee dashboards, scheduled reports, and ad hoc research for business decisions.
  • Provide support for client VLB requests and escalations.
  • Document procedures and train internal teams and customers on banking portals and processes.

Let's See if We're a Match:

  • Advanced Excel skills including pivot tables, VLOOKUPs, and data manipulation.
  • 3-5 years of experience in data analysis, product management, or business systems analysis.
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to train others and collaborate cross-functionally.
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Business Administration, Statistics, Information Technology or a related field.
  • Familiarity with SQL, Power BI, and workflow automation tools preferred.
  • Ability to work in a hybrid environment and be onsite 1-2 days per week. Local candidates preferred.
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to multi-task, managing multiple projects simultaneously across different verticals and departments.
  • A self-starter that can take initiative and is solutions driven.
